Project Manager (MarTech)

We're partnering with a well-established consumer business that's investing heavily in its digital and customer experience capabilities. This is an opportunity to lead high-impact transformation projects, bringing together technology, marketing, data, and commercial teams to deliver meaningful change.

Role Overview

  • Location: London – Hybrid (3 days per week on-site)
  • Package: £Competitive per day (Inside IR35)
  • Industry: Consumer / Digital Transformation

What You'll Be Doing

  • Lead the delivery of strategic MarTech and customer experience transformation projects from initiation through to completion.
  • Manage the implementation and migration of customer platforms, ensuring successful delivery across multiple workstreams.
  • Develop and maintain project plans, delivery roadmaps, RAID logs, governance documentation, and reporting.
  • Coordinate internal teams alongside external suppliers and delivery partners to keep projects on track.
  • Oversee budgets, timelines, risks, dependencies, and stakeholder expectations throughout the project lifecycle.
  • Facilitate governance meetings, steering groups, and regular updates for senior stakeholders.
  • Work closely with Product, Marketing, Data, Digital, Engineering, Architecture, Commercial, and PMO teams.
  • Support business readiness, change management, testing, deployment, and successful platform adoption.
  • Identify potential risks early, remove delivery blockers, and drive continuous improvement across project delivery.

Main Skills Needed

  • Proven experience delivering MarTech, CRM, Digital, or Customer Experience transformation programmes.
  • Strong background managing technology implementations, platform migrations, or customer data initiatives.
  • Experience working with customer data platforms (CDPs), CRM, or marketing technology solutions.
  • Exposure to commercial technology such as pricing, revenue management, or optimisation platforms.
  • Excellent stakeholder management skills with the confidence to engage senior business leaders.
  • Strong knowledge of Agile, Waterfall, or hybrid delivery methodologies.
  • Skilled in project governance, planning, reporting, and risk management.
  • Experience managing multiple suppliers and cross-functional delivery teams.
  • Excellent communication, organisation, and problem-solving skills.
  • Experience with platforms such as Adobe Experience Cloud, Salesforce Marketing Cloud, Tealium, Bloomreach, Braze, or similar would be beneficial.
  • Professional certifications such as PRINCE2, AgilePM, MSP, or PMP are advantageous.
